The Witcher was one of the most anticipated new shows of 2019, and the first season of the Netflix series did not disappoint.
The fantasy drama, which could switch from a whimsical buddy comedy to a gory horror story at moment's notice, enthralled viewers who now can't wait to return to The Continent for Season 2.
The Witcher is inspired by Andrzej Sapkowski's Witcher book series, which also spawned the popular video game franchise. The show stars Henry Cavill as Geralt of Rivia, a witcher whose destiny becomes bound to the sorceress Yennefer (Anya Chalotra) and the powerful princess Ciri (Freya Allan).
